The Beginner's Blueprint to Home Workouts

Embarking on a fitness journey from the comfort of your home can be both exciting and daunting for beginners. However, with the right blueprint in hand, anyone can turn their living room into a personal gym. Home workouts offer an array of benefits including convenience, privacy, and cost-effectiveness. They eliminate commuting time to the gym and provide flexibility that aligns seamlessly with one’s schedule.

The beginner’s blueprint to home workouts starts with setting clear goals. Whether it’s weight loss, muscle gain or just improving overall physical health – defining what you want to achieve is crucial. It provides direction and keeps you motivated throughout your journey.

Next comes planning your workout routine which should ideally include a mix of cardio exercises like running or cycling along with strength training exercises such as push-ups or squats. Beginners are advised to start slow and gradually increase intensity over time to avoid injury.

A key component of any workout plan is consistency. Aim for at least 30 minutes of moderate-intensity exercise most days of the week. This could be broken down into smaller sessions if necessary but ensuring regularity is imperative for seeing results.

Nutrition plays an equally important role in achieving fitness goals as working out does; hence it cannot be overlooked in this blueprint. A balanced diet rich in protein helps build muscle while complex carbohydrates provide energy needed for workouts.

Investing in basic equipment such as dumbbells or resistance bands can enhance home workouts but are not necessarily required when starting out since bodyweight exercises can also deliver effective results.

Safety should always be prioritized during home workouts especially without professional supervision available like at gyms. Proper form must be maintained during all exercises to prevent injuries – there are numerous tutorials available online that demonstrate correct techniques for each exercise type which beginners should familiarize themselves with before starting off.

Lastly, tracking progress serves as great motivation along this fitness journey – whether through maintaining a workout journal or using fitness apps that record data such as calories burned and workout duration.

The beginner’s blueprint to home workouts is not a one-size-fits-all plan – it should be tailored according to individual needs, capabilities and preferences. It’s about finding what works best for you, adapting along the way and most importantly, enjoying the process.

In conclusion, starting a home workout routine may seem challenging initially but with clear goals, a well-planned routine, consistency in workouts and diet, safety measures in place and regular tracking of progress – beginners can effectively embark on this rewarding journey towards achieving their fitness goals right from the comfort of their homes.
